+/*
+ * Get depth of visual specified by visualid
+ *
+ */
+uint16_t get_visual_depth(xcb_visualid_t visual_id){
+ xcb_depth_iterator_t depth_iter;
+
+ depth_iter = xcb_screen_allowed_depths_iterator(root_screen);
+ for (; depth_iter.rem; xcb_depth_next(&depth_iter)) {
+ xcb_visualtype_iterator_t visual_iter;
+
+ visual_iter = xcb_depth_visuals_iterator(depth_iter.data);
+ for (; visual_iter.rem; xcb_visualtype_next(&visual_iter)) {
+ if (visual_id == visual_iter.data->visual_id) {
+ return depth_iter.data->depth;
+ }
+ }
+ }
+ return 0;
+}
+
+/*
+ * Get visualid with specified depth
+ *
+ */
+xcb_visualid_t get_visualid_by_depth(uint16_t depth){
+ xcb_depth_iterator_t depth_iter;
+
+ depth_iter = xcb_screen_allowed_depths_iterator(root_screen);
+ for (; depth_iter.rem; xcb_depth_next(&depth_iter)) {
+ if (depth_iter.data->depth != depth)
+ continue;
+
+ xcb_visualtype_iterator_t visual_iter;
+
+ visual_iter = xcb_depth_visuals_iterator(depth_iter.data);
+ if (!visual_iter.rem)
+ continue;
+ return visual_iter.data->visual_id;
+ }
+ return 0;
+}
